A New Presumed Commit Optimization for Two Phase Commit

Summary: Introduces a presumed-commit 2PC variant that reduces coordinator logging below presumed abort while retaining presumed commit’s lower message cost. It trades this efficiency for permanently retained, small crash-related metadata. (summarized by gpt-5.6-luna on Jul 24 2026)
